This is a specialised gear drive assembly, not a standard reduction gearbox. The unit has an external manual lever-actuated clutch mechanism and appears to incorporate a positive dog clutch together with an overrunning / sprag clutch arrangement.
The sprag clutch arrangement would allow one-way torque transmission or overrunning/freewheeling, while the lever-operated dog clutch provides positive mechanical engagement/disengagement of the drive.
This type of unit may have been designed for a heavy industrial auxiliary drive, dual-drive system, barring drive, conveyor, mill, process plant, mining equipment or other machinery requiring controlled engagement and one-way overrunning.
